BOARD OF TRUSTEES

Atty. Aileen San Juan Manalo

Chairperson

ATTY. AILEEN SJ. MANALO was a college graduate from the University of Santo Tomas with a degree in Bachelor of Commerce – Major in Economics. She completed her Bachelor of Laws in Arellano University School of Laws and was admitted to the bar in 2007.

She was part of the legal team of one of the largest privately-owned Philippine commercial banks in the country. Afterwards, she became one of the legal counsels of a conglomerate with diversified business activities that includes beverages, banking, and property development, among others.

Rafael E. Seguis

Vice-Chairperson & Trustee

He started his career in Foreign Service when he joined the Department of Foreign Affairs as Technical Assistant until his last position as Undersecretary for Civilian Security and Consular Concerns, receiving several awards and recognitions. He obtained his degree in Business Administration from the University of the East and passed the Certified Public Accountants Board Examinations. He also attended postgraduate studies at the American University in Cairo and the Ateneo de Manila Graduate School of Business.

Atty. Gil Carlos R. Puyat IV

Trustee

A graduate of San Francisco State University with a degree in Economics and a Bachelor of Laws at the Lyceum of the Philippines Law School.

Before starting a private practice, he served as a Public Attorney II at the Public Attorneys Office (PAO) – Manila District, and then later as an Attorney II at the Bureau of Internal Revenue (BIR) – Litigation Division at the National Office.

Danilo Crisostomo V. Singson

Trustee

After he finished his Management Engineering degree from the University of Ateneo de Manila, he joined a polyester manufacturing company where he exposed himself to deliveries, shipment, and inventory control. It was when he started his career in logistics, warehousing, and shipping management. He also holds a master’s degree in business administration from the Ateneo Graduate School of Business.

Atty. Vincent Steve P. Badong

Trustee

He is a lawyer by profession. He also holds a master’s degree in business administration from the Philippine Christian University. He headed the Business Development department of the Mega Data Corporation and worked as an Administrator of the micro, small, and medium enterprises in the Development Bank of the Philippines.
